netlist: fix bugs and more cpp instead of macros (#9897)
* netlist: fix bugs and more cpp instead of macros
- C-style comments converted to c++
- Fix crash in state saving code when an abort queue processing event
is pending.
- Fix a bug where a net could be twice in the queue.
- Convert more macros to c++
- fixed SUBTARGET=nl build
- fixed potential bugs which would allow a terminal to belong to more
than one net. This is not possible even for a short time.
- moved some member function definitions out-of-class.
- moved code out-of-class
- added constexpr where appropriate
- fixed mamenl build
- Cleanup and indentation
